Summary:Thirty-two strains of Pectobacterium carotovorum ssp. (Pec) were isolated from Chinese cabbage and other vegetables. These strains were subject to morphological observation, biochemical and physiological identification as well as 16S rDNA sequence analysis. All strains except D4, Z1-2, Z2-1, Z2-2 and Z3-2 manifested the same PCR patterns as indicated by amplifying 16S-23S rDNA ITS and ITS-RFLP. The phylogenetic analysis of the 16S rDNA sequences indicated that these five strains that clustered with Pec strain PCI and close to P. betavasculorum and P. wasabiae were distinct from other strains in the Pec groups. However, the whole-cell fatty acid analysis and the biochemical and physiological characteristics suggested that these five strains could still be identified as Pec. In conclusion, our results suggest that these five strains are probably from a new evolutionary taxonomy oí Pectobacterium carotovorum ssp.
